1. In a well-known quote, Socrates said, "The unexamined life is ___________."
Answer: Not worth living
2. Socrates was convicted of which two crimes?
Answer: "impiety" (atheism) and corrupting the youth of Athens
3. The word philosophy comes from the Greek word meaning what?
Answer: "love of wisdom"
4. What was the name of Plato's famous dialogue in which he described love?
Answer: Symposium
